Quirks:
Until end of Summer, there are this many opportunities to encourage/discourage quirks:
13x Rogue.History.update("submissiveness_encouraged")
8x Rogue.History.update("masochism_encouraged")
8x Laura.History.update("dominance_encouraged")
6x Laura.History.update("protectiveness_encouraged")
9x Jean.History.update("dominance_encouraged")
8x Jean.History.update("siblings_encouraged")

Whenever you encourage a quirk (thumb-up) at least two times more than discouraging it, the quirk will be added to the girl's database. Enc-Disc >= 2 = Quirk added.
There are definitely checks if a quirk has been encouraged or discouraged before, what will change dialogue accordingly although without significant story impact so far.
The girls will keep offering the mentioned numbers of opportunities to either encourage their behavior or not.
At least until end of Winter, there is no real disadvantage in discouraging the girls' quirks. Sometimes you get even a little more points as reward when denying, or often no points at all no matter whatever you choose to do in these special decisions.
If someone doesn't like these, discourage them, but there is no real way to completely shut their special behavior off for the rest of the story so far. These are pesky quirks after all that can be hardly get rid off.

All these events are tied to a random roll for each time of the day. As long as the girls are in normal mood and not following the player then these objective spawns should happen....sometimes. You can always try to quickload a save that typically also rerolls these chances.
Some objectives can only happen at a certain time but these are rather rare. Mouse hover over the objective text reveals details.
